Ordinals
beta
Address bc1q4evhur2ejvx45ukjked7hychu5euy4hd3vlxsx
sat balance
47359
outputs
93e77138236c1a9ee268b50d2ec971aa2d69d477086b12c4441a0a1fcf491c1b:0